Coronavirus: 2 new cases of COVID-19 in London-Middlesex, total rises to 23

The total number of COVID-19 cases in London and Middlesex rose by two on Friday after health officials with the Middlesex-London Health Unit confirmed cases involving people in their 20s and 30s.

One case involves a male in his 20s, who contracted COVID-19 through travel to an unspecified location. The other involves a woman in her 30s whose transmission source hasn’t been determined.

It comes after two cases were confirmed in the region on Thursday, one involving a hospitalized male in his 20s who contracted the novel coronavirus through undetermined means, and a woman in her 30s who became infected during a recent trip to the U.S.
